Newark Airport Information
Newark Liberty International Airport sits between Newark and Elizabeth, New Jersey, and is roughly 15 miles from Midtown Manhattan. Serving more than 33 million passengers each year, this airport offers domestic and international flights from Newark. Newark Liberty serves as a hub for United Airlines, and most major airlines offer flights from this airport. Parking at Newark Airport
You can find both short-term and long-term parking lots at Newark Liberty Airport; the costs vary depending on which lot you use and how long you park. Long-term parking starts at $18 for 24 hours and goes up from there. Parking in the short-term lot starts at $3 for the first half-hour. Transportation to Newark Airport
People from all over New Jersey, New York and surrounding areas use Newark Airport. Driving to the airport is simple, but parking costs can get expensive. Other options are more economical. AirTrain Newark goes to the airport from major train stations in New Jersey and New York, and you can catch a bus from many PATH train stations and the Port Authority in Midtown Manhattan. Taxis and car services provide convenient transport, and these options work best for people traveling with children or a lot of luggage. Weather in Fort Wayne
The weather in Fort Wayne varies from temperatures in the teens during the winter to the 80s during the summer. Because of this, you should check the weather forecast before leaving for your vacation. During the winter, a warm coat, gloves and a hat are must-haves. During the summer, short-sleeved shirts and lightweight fabrics are ideal.
